it all depends on what you can do and what you are willing to spend if you can't. shop around. i got an 83 sc with 106k for $9500 a few months back but i have also put a few thousand into it in the 2+ months i have owned it. if i had taken it to a shop and let them do everything it would be in the $6-7k range to date but doing most of the work myself and with a mechanic from my local pca i have saved around $4k of those costs.
